‘Generation Axe—The Guitars That Destroyed the World: Live in China’ To Be Released in June
Listen to Vai, Malmsteen, Zakk Wylde and Tosin Abasi shred through Edgar Winter's "Frankenstein."
A live recording from the Generation Axe tour, featuring Steve Vai, Yngwie Malmsteen, Zakk Wylde, Nuno Bettencourt and Tosin Abasi, will be released on June 28. Titled Generation Axe—The Guitars That Destroyed the World: Live In China, the collection culls performances from the tour’s 11-city run in Asia in 2017. The album will be released via earMUSIC as a CD digipak, limited colored 2LP+download and digital.
In advance of the release, you can check out a live recording of the Edgar Winter Group’s “Frankenstein” from Live in China above.
Said Steve Vai about the Generation Axe show, “The idea was to create a seamless show with one backing band and five completely accomplished and astonishing guitarists that take to the stage in various configurations, performing some of their solo music and merging together as cohesive co-creators of lushly orchestrated guitar extravaganzas.”
